• Предмет: Информатика
  • Автор: xrennn
  • Вопрос задан 5 месяцев назад

Вывести на экран таблицу значений функции y=(x*x+5)/(2*x + sqrt(x)) на интервале от +2 до +10. Значение аргумента выводятся с шагом h=0,4​

Приложения:

Ответы

Ответ дал: falusytubejaste
0

Вот код на Python, который выводит таблицу значений функции y=(xx+5)/(2x + sqrt(x)) на интервале от +2 до +10 с шагом h=0,4:

import math

print("x \t y")

x = 2

h = 0.4

while x <= 10:

y = (x*x + 5)/(2*x + math.sqrt(x))

print("{:.1f} \t {:.3f}".format(x, y))

x += h

Вывод:

x y

2.0 1.390

2.4 1.429

2.8 1.461

3.2 1.487

3.6 1.509

4.0 1.527

4.4 1.542

4.8 1.555

5.2 1.565

5.6 1.574

6.0 1.582

6.4 1.588

6.8 1.594

7.2 1.598

7.6 1.602

8.0 1.605

8.4 1.607

8.8 1.609

9.2 1.610

9.6 1.611

10.0 1.612

Вас заинтересует